How huffman coding is used to compress data
Web12 dec. 2024 · H uffman coding is a lossless data compression algorithm that is used to compress data in a way that minimizes the number of bits used to represent the data. It … WebThis project's purpose is to build a data compression method which is to read specific data from, our goal is to express the same data in a smaller amount of space. Our objective is …
How huffman coding is used to compress data
Did you know?
Web21 feb. 2024 · Huffman Coding takes advantage of that fact, and encodes the text so that the most used characters take up less space than the less common ones. Encoding a String Let's use Huffman... Web26 mei 2024 · The core of file compression is to generate Huffman coding, and the process of Huffman coding needs to find the minimum weight and sub-minimum weight …
WebHuffman coding algorithm is a data compression algorithm that works by creating a binary tree of nodes. All nodes contain the character itself and priority queue is applied to build a binary tree. 4. RUNLENGTH Algorithm Run length compression or Run Length Encoding (RLE) works by reducing the physical size of a repeating string of characters. Web21 feb. 2024 · Suppose we want to compress a string (Huffman coding can be used with any data, but strings make good examples). Inevitably, some characters will appear …
Web20 nov. 2016 · Huffman Coding It is an entropy-encoding algorithm, used for lossless data compression. It uses a variable length code table for encoding a character in a file. Its …
WebThe Huffman algorithm will create a tree with leaves as the found letters and for value (or weight) their number of occurrences in the message. To create this tree, look for the 2 …
Web4 sep. 2024 · September 4, 2024. In computer science and information theory, Huffman coding is an entropy encoding algorithm used for lossless data compression. The … dog pram ukWeb5 aug. 2024 · Huffman Coding - Huffman coding is lossless data compression algorithm. In this algorithm a variable-length code is assigned to input different characters. The … dog prams ukWebHuffman codes use a static model and construct codes like that illustrated earlier in the four-letter alphabet. Arithmetic coding encodes strings of symbols as ranges of real numbers and achieves more nearly optimal codes. It is slower than Huffman coding but is suitable for adaptive models. dog prebioticsWeb4 apr. 2024 · We use the Huffman Coding algorithm for this purpose which is a greedy algorithm that assigns variable length binary codes for each input character in the … dog prednisone doseWebData Compression and Huffman Encoding Handout written by Julie Zelenski. In the early 1980s, personal computers had hard disks that were no larger than 10MB; today, the … dog prank gone wrongWebHuffman Code: A Huffman code is a particular type of optimal prefix code that is commonly used for lossless data compression. The process of finding or using such a … dog prednisone dosageWebHuffman-Compression-Algorithm. as a project during data structures and algorithms course we were asked to imlpement the Huffman compression code using java. Also … dog prednisone